Machine Learning Implementation Manager – London – Hybrid – Excellent salary + Bonus + Career Development


Overview

An exciting opportunity has arisen with a global insurance company for a Machine Learning Implementation Manager. You will develop cutting edge solutions that put analytics at the heart of decision-making. You will work closely with other members of the Strategic Analytics team on high-profile analytics projects that drive business strategies. As a key member of the implementation engineering team, you will extend the capacity to deliver and push the team forward.


Role & Responsibilities

Lead Orchestration of real-time predictive analytic solutions leveraging Azure Data Factory, Function Apps and other tools

Manage deployments of real time analytics services

Use SQL, Python and Snowflake to understand underlying data, and suggest improvements for performance and best practices

Lead collaboration with project stakeholders and other developers

Manage code development and deployment using Azure Data Factory, VS Code and GitHub

Contribute and promote evolving best practices

Document and manage technical workflows and implementation processes


Essential skills and experience

  • 2+ years of leading data/implementation engineering projects
  • 2+ years of Python development experience
  • 2+ years of API development experience
  • Demonstrated experience building data structures to support analytics/research/actuarial functions in an insurance company setting
  • Experience with cloud technologies like Snowflake and Databricks
  • Familiarity with the MLOps framework
  • Exceptional collaboration and relationship building skills
  • Comfortable handling ambiguous concepts and breaking down complex problems into manageable pieces
  • Strong data manipulation skills for analytics
  • Resilient problem solving and critical thinking skills
  • Thorough understanding of data warehousing concepts and design
  • Ability to communicate effectively to different target audiences
  • Flexibility – able to meet changing requirements and priorities

Desirable:

Experience with Azure Functions is a plus
